In another classic Ed Boon manoeuvre, the Mortal Kombat co-founder has shared yet another enigmatic clue concerning Mortal Kombat 1, sparking rumours of veteran combatants making a grand comeback. After relentless fan conjecture, May finally saw the unveiling of the latest chapter in the Mortal Kombat saga, through a graphic and awe-inspiring CGI teaser trailer. The promising MK 1 Reboot is poised to breathe new life into the series post-MK 11, following the freshly appointed Fire God Liu Kang as he shapes a tranquil world that is promptly challenged by the resurrection of Shang Tsung.

Fan Favourites Secured for the New Universe

Evidently, the faithful followers of the franchise are keen to see how the reboot presents well-known characters. Besides Liu Kang and Shang Tsung, the MK 1 trailer confirmed that crowd favourites such as Scorpion, Sub-Zero, Kung Lao, Princess Kitana, and Mileena would be part of the revamped universe. In addition, Johnny Cage, a constant figure in Mortal Kombat, will feature an alternate costume mirroring celebrated action hero Jean-Claude Van Damme. Of course, with the promise of a new gameplay trailer at this week’s Summer Game Fest, there’s plenty of scope for more familiar faces to rise from the depths in Mortal Kombat 1.

Ed Boon’s Teaser Adds Fuel to Speculation

Ed Boon Classic MK1 Characters Tease

In a recent tweet, Ed Boon, the co-creator of Mortal Kombat, dropped another tantalising hint feeding into the speculation around Mortal Kombat 1’s lineup. Boon is no stranger to interacting with the MK community on social media. His new enigmatic message features the character selection screen from the 1997 classic, Mortal Kombat 4, with a cryptic note about some of the showcased characters “venturing back into action.”

Predictably, Boon’s tweet has sparked a flurry of theories among Mortal Kombat aficionados regarding which MK 4 participants he may be alluding to. A dragon emoji accompanying the post has led some to speculate that Reptile, the serpentine ninja missing from MK 11, might stage a triumphant return. Another guess points to Reiko, a devoted general to Shao Khan, once rumoured to be the Outworld despot reincarnated. And then there’s Jarek, the rough-and-tumble member of the Black Dragon clan, whose return could signal the comeback of the nefarious Kano.

In the reinvented Mortal Kombat 1 universe, anything seems possible, and Boon continues to keep the embers of speculation alive with his recent Mortal Kombat-themed social media posts. We might get more clarity about the returning characters in Mortal Kombat 1 during the upcoming gameplay trailer at the Summer Game Fest. Until then, fans can only speculate about which MK 4 fighters might join the next showdown.

Mortal Kombat 1 will be released on September 19th, available on PS5, Switch, Windows PC and Xbox Series X.
